Fun outdoors activities for small children during late summer and autumn:

Gather fallen leaves and acorns and use them as craft materials

We live nearby a beautiful forest, so we occasionally we take long walks through the forest. So it happens that we always get home with a lot of green, yellow or brown leaves and acorns. They are great as craft materials for various decorative objects or we create funny figurines with hats and autumn themed collages.

Outdoor dancing

When we go outside, we sometimes take our portable bluetooth speaker with us. Our daughter and her friends love to dance together in nature. Her favorite dancing songs are: Tschu Tschu WaAram Sam Sam (she studies German in kindergarten), and Socu, Bate, Vira. Dancing in nature is a great way to exercise and have lots of fun, at the same time.

Fly a kite

We love to go to the park when the wind is light and fly our kite. We have this Rainbow Kite for Kids which is extremely easy to control. Flying a kite is a fun activity for both children and adults It also helps children to develop coordination and critical thinking skills in a very practical setting.

Painting rocks and play hide and seek with them

Our daughter loves to paint, especially rocks and shells. So, we got inspired by this kit: Creativity for Kids Hide and Seek Rock Painting Kit and started painting rocks together. Then, me and my husband hid them outside and let our girl find them. She has lots of fun painting and finding them, too.
